The latest iPhone Fold dummy floating around online provides a good picture of what Apple’s first folding phone could become. Built from 3D-printed plastic and based on leaked screen information and specifications, this mockup folds up into a nice little rectangle before opening up to reveal a much larger display.



When closed, the device is around the same height as an ancient iPhone 4, but somewhat wider than the current 17 Pro Max. The reason for the breadth is a 5.3-inch outer screen with a strange, short 2:3 aspect ratio, which is extremely different from the super tall, slender screens Apple has utilized since the iPhone X. One-handed use feels really awkward because your thumb covers the majority of the screen but it’s difficult to reach the far side without altering your hold. The little square corner at the bottom left, which gets its shape from the hinge positioning, is bound to catch on something in a pocket, although Apple will probably fix that before manufacturing.

When you open it, a 7.7-inch inner screen appears, laid out in landscape and with a squarish 4:3 aspect ratio more suited to an iPad Mini than a phone. When fully extended, the device is around 167.6 mm wide by 120.6 mm tall, providing ample space for two apps side by side or a complete keyboard without feeling cramped. One thing is for certain: you can now use both hands, and your reach now extends practically the entire screen, with the exception of a small area at the very top.

The camera is positioned horizontally on the rear, with two lenses side by side in landscape mode. This should allow you to film all sorts of beautiful spatial footage, and it works well with all of the other camera features you’ve come to expect from previous iPhones, such as wide and ultrawide settings for all that fancy macro and portrait business. The pill-shaped camera appears to have been lifted from another recent phone model, but the mockup remains simplistic, with no attempt to jam in any genuine lenses or sensors.

What about the buttons and ports? There’s one noticeable button near the camera that could be an action button, and another down at the bottom that could control power or volume. Those speaker grilles look a little weird, with one tiny hole at the bottom and two at the top, which doesn’t give us much faith that the audio output will be equivalent to a conventional iPhone.

Thickness-wise, it appears to be roughly 9.6 mm when folded up in CAD renders, which is slightly higher than some of the current crop of iPhones but fair given the complexity of the folding mechanism. In terms of weight, the plastic mockup weighs almost nothing, so who knows what it’ll be like once they start putting in some genuine glass, aluminum, and components. The hinge itself opens and shuts rather easily, however this differs when you consider the precision damping and magnets that you’d expect from an Apple device.

According to leaks, this will be released in 2026, potentially alongside the iPhone 18 series. Screen sizes appear to be approximately consistent across the board: 5.3 to 5.4 inches on the exterior and 7.7 to 7.8 inches on the inside. Apple is aiming for a tiny little device that just happens to expand into tablet territory, rather than the tall, book-style fold that other manufacturers use.
